@media (max-width:640px) {
body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, p, span, em, a, strong, pre, code, form, fieldset, legend, lable, table, input, button, textarea, p, blockquote, tr, th, td, hr{ border:0 none; font-size:100%; font-style:inherit; font-weight:inherit; margin:0; padding:0; outline:0 none; vertical-align:baseline;}
body { color:#222; font-size:14px; font-family:"微软雅黑", Arial, Helvetica, sans-serif; background:#EDF4F5;}
a{ color:#333; text-decoration:none;}
a:hover{ text-decoration:none; color:#1368AC;}
a img { border:0 none;}
em, b{ font-weight:normal; font-style:normal;}
ol, ul { list-style:none outside none;}
ul li {list-style:none outside none;}
hr{ box-sizing:content-box; height:0;}
.clear{ clear:both;}
.clearfix:after { content:""; display:block; height:0; clear:both; visibility:hidden;}
.clearfix{ display:block;}
.l{ float:left}
.r{ float:right;}

/*头部和底部*/
.headerbox{ width:100%; height:60px; padding:10px; box-sizing:border-box; background:url(../images/nav_bj.jpg) repeat-x; position:fixed; top:0; left:0; z-index:9999;}
.headerbox .top_nav{ float:left; display:inline-block; width:34px; height:40px; cursor:pointer; background:url(../images/nav_btn.png) center no-repeat;}
.headerbox .logo{ float:left; width:auto; height:30px; padding:5px 0 5px 15px; margin:0px; background:none;}
.headerbox .logo img{ height:100%;}
.search{ float:right; display:inline-block; height:23px; line-height:23px; padding:3px 5px 3px 5px; color:#999; background:#fff /*url(../images/search.png) right center no-repeat*/; margin:7px 0; width:30%;}
.search_bar form .keywords{ width:82%;}
.search_bar form .submit{ width:18%;}


.m-mobile-nav{ width:100%; background:#3C3C3C; display:none; overflow:hidden; position:absolute; left:0; top:60px; z-index:999;}
.m-mobile-nav li{ width:100%; border-bottom:1px solid #545558;}
.m-mobile-nav li .tit{ display:block; height:46px; line-height:46px;}
.m-mobile-nav li .tit a{ display:block; padding:0 10px; height:46px; line-height:46px; color:#aaa;}
.m-mobile-nav li .tit a:hover{ color:#fff;}
.m-mobile-nav li .tit b{ width:20px; height:18px; display:inline-block; vertical-align:top; margin:12px 10px 0 0; background-size:100% !important;}
.m-mobile-nav li .tit b.n01{ background:url(../images/dh01.png) no-repeat;}
.m-mobile-nav li .tit b.n02{ background:url(../images/dh02.png) no-repeat;}
.m-mobile-nav li .tit b.n03{ background:url(../images/dh03.png) no-repeat;}
.m-mobile-nav li .tit b.n04{ background:url(../images/dh04.png) no-repeat;}
.m-mobile-nav li .tit b.n05{ background:url(../images/dh05.png) no-repeat;}
.m-mobile-nav li .tit b.n06{ background:url(../images/dh06.png) no-repeat;}
.m-mobile-nav li .tit b.n07{ background:url(../images/dh07.png) no-repeat;}
.m-mobile-nav li .tit b.n08{ background:url(../images/dh08.png) no-repeat;}
.m-mobile-nav li .sub-box{ width:100%;background-color:#f6f6f6;display:none;}
.m-mobile-nav li .sub-box p{ width:100%; display: block;}
.m-mobile-nav li .sub-box p a{ display:block; text-align:center; height:34px;line-height:34px; color:#0978CB;}

.flexslider{ width:100%; position:relative; height:160px; padding-top:60px; overflow:hidden; background:url(../images/loading.gif) 50% no-repeat;}
.flexslider .slides{ position:relative; z-index:0;}
.flexslider .slides li{ height:160px;}
.flexslider .slides li a{ width:100%; height:160px; display:block;}
.flexslider .flex-control-nav{ position:absolute; bottom:10px; z-index:2;width:100%;text-align:center;}
.flexslider .flex-control-nav li{display:inline-block;width:13px;height:13px;margin:0 3px;*display:inline;zoom:1;}
.flexslider .flex-control-nav a{display:inline-block;width:13px;height:13px;line-height:50px;overflow:hidden;background:url(../images/dot1.png) right 0 no-repeat;cursor:pointer;}
.flexslider .flex-control-nav .flex-active{background-position:0 0;}

.top_menu{ padding:5px;}
.top_menu ul{ width:100%;}
.top_menu ul li{ padding:5px; width:33.33%; float:left; text-align:center; box-sizing:border-box;}
.top_menu ul li a{ float:left; display:block; width:100%; padding:10px 0; background:#fff;}
.top_menu ul li a b{ width:50px; height:50px; display:inline-block; background-size:100% !important; margin-bottom:5px;}
.top_menu ul li a b.t01{ background:url(../images/t01.png) no-repeat;}
.top_menu ul li a b.t02{ background:url(../images/t02.png) no-repeat;}
.top_menu ul li a b.t03{ background:url(../images/t03.png) no-repeat;}
.top_menu ul li a b.t04{ background:url(../images/t04.png) no-repeat;}
.top_menu ul li a b.t05{ background:url(../images/t05.png) no-repeat;}
.top_menu ul li a b.t06{ background:url(../images/t06.png) no-repeat;}

.index_info{ padding:0 10px 10px;}
.info_box{ background:#fff; padding:10px 0;}
.info_box h2{ height:16px; line-height:16px; border-left:5px solid #1368AC; padding-left:10px; margin-bottom:5px;}
.info_box .study01{ width:100%;}
.info_box .study01 li{ width:25%; float:left; text-align:center; padding:10px 0 0;}
.info_box .study01 li a{ float:left; display:block; width:100%;}
.info_box .study01 li b{ width:48px; height:48px; display:inline-block; background-size:100% !important; margin-bottom:5px;}
.info_box .study01 li b.i01{ background:url(../images/i01.png) no-repeat;}
.info_box .study01 li b.i02{ background:url(../images/i02.png) no-repeat;}
.info_box .study01 li b.i03{ background:url(../images/i03.png) no-repeat;}
.info_box .study01 li b.i04{ background:url(../images/i04.png) no-repeat;}
.info_box .study01 li b.i05{ background:url(../images/i05.png) no-repeat;}
.info_box .study01 li b.i06{ background:url(../images/i06.png) no-repeat;}
.info_box .study01 li b.i07{ background:url(../images/i07.png) no-repeat;}
.info_box .study01 li b.i08{ background:url(../images/i08.png) no-repeat;}

.info_box .study02{ width:100%;}
.info_box .study02 li{ width:33.33%; float:left; text-align:center; padding:10px 0 0;}
.info_box .study02 li a{ float:left; display:block; width:100%;}
.info_box .study02 li b{ width:55px; height:55px; display:inline-block; background-size:100% !important; margin-bottom:5px;}
.info_box .study02 li b.c01{ background:url(../images/c01.png) no-repeat;}
.info_box .study02 li b.c02{ background:url(../images/c02.png) no-repeat;}
.info_box .study02 li b.c03{ background:url(../images/c03.png) no-repeat;}
.info_box .study02 li b.c04{ background:url(../images/c04.png) no-repeat;}
.info_box .study02 li b.c05{ background:url(../images/c05.png) no-repeat;}
.info_box .study02 li b.c06{ background:url(../images/c06.png) no-repeat;}
.info_box .study02 li b.c07{ background:url(../images/c07.png) no-repeat;}
.info_box .study02 li b.c08{ background:url(../images/c08.png) no-repeat;}
.info_box .study02 li b.c09{ background:url(../images/c09.png) no-repeat;}

.index_news{ padding:0 10px 10px;}
.news_box{ background:#fff;}

.news_box .tab_tit{ width:100%;}
.news_box .tab_tit li{ float:left; width:25%; height:46px; line-height:46px; text-align:center; color:#fff; border-left:1px solid #fff; margin-left:-1px; background:#175176;}
.news_box .tab_tit li.hover{ background:#F7941D;}
.news_box .tabBox .tabCon ul li{ padding:10px; border-bottom:1px solid #E8E6E6;}
.news_box .tabBox .tabCon ul li .pic{ width:140px; height:86px; float:left; display:block; margin-right:10px; overflow:hidden;}
.news_box .tabBox .tabCon ul li .pic img{ width:100%;}
.news_box .tabBox .tabCon ul li h2{ padding:10px 0; height:66px; line-height:33px; overflow:hidden;}
.news_box .more{ width:100%; height:46px; line-height:46px; text-align:center; color:#999; background:#E8E6E6; display:block;}

.news_box .tabBox .tabCon table{}
.news_box .tabBox .tabCon table td{ padding:2px 0 !important; margin:0px !important; height:26px !important; overflow:hidden; }
.news_box .tabBox .tabCon table td.newsdate{ display:none;}
/*.news_box .tabBox .tabCon table td:last-child{ display:none;}*/

.copyright{ background:#175176; padding:10px 0px; margin-bottom:64px; color:#fff; text-align:center; line-height:22px; font-size:12px;}
.footer_menu{ background:#F7941D; color:#fff; position:fixed; left:0px; bottom:0px; width:100%;}
.footer_menu li{ width:25%; text-align:center; border-left:1px solid #fff; margin-left:-1px; float:left;}
.footer_menu li a{ width:100%; padding:8px 0; color:#fff; display:block;}
.footer_menu li a b{ width:22px; height:22px; display:inline-block; background-size:100% !important; margin-bottom:2px;}
.footer_menu li a b.m01{ background:url(../images/m01.png) no-repeat;}
.footer_menu li a b.m02{ background:url(../images/m02.png) no-repeat;}
.footer_menu li a b.m03{ background:url(../images/m03.png) no-repeat;}
.footer_menu li a b.m04{ background:url(../images/m04.png) no-repeat;}

.position{ padding:10px; height:24px; line-height:24px; color:#666; overflow:hidden;}
.position b{ width:16px; height:24px; background:url(../images/post.png) no-repeat; background-size:100% !important; display:inline-block; vertical-align:top; margin:0 5px 0 0;}
.position a{ color:#666;}
.index_news h3{ height:46px; line-height:46px; text-align:center; color:#fff; font-size:15px; background:#175176; overflow:hidden;}
.index_news h4{ padding:10px; text-align:center; font-size:16px;}
.index_news .time{ padding:0 10px 10px; text-align:center; color:#999; border-bottom:1px solid #ddd; margin:0 10px 10px;}
.index_news .text{ padding:10px; line-height:26px;}
.index_news .text img{ max-width:100%; height:auto;}
.index_news .text iframe{ width:100% !important; height:260px !important;}


.share{ width:100%; margin-bottom:10px;}
.share li{ float:left; width:33.33%; text-align:center;}
.share li a{ width:100%; display:block;}
.share li a b{ width:42px; height:42px; display:inline-block; background-size:100% !important; margin-bottom:2px;}
.share li a b.s01{ background:url(../images/icon_weixin.png) no-repeat;}
.share li a b.s02{ background:url(../images/icon_weibo.png) no-repeat;}
.share li a b.s03{ background:url(../images/icon_qq.png) no-repeat;}



.pc{ display:none;}
.ph{ display:block;}


#Piao_L,#doyoo_monitor,#doyoo_panel{ display:none !important;}



}